Overview of Toyo University

Toyo University, established in 1887, is a prominent private university located in Tokyo, Japan. With over 135 years of history, Toyo has grown into one of Japan’s largest private universities, nurturing a tradition of academic excellence and social contribution. The university operates multiple campuses, the main being in Bunkyo, Tokyo, and additional sites across the Greater Tokyo Area. Toyo is a comprehensive institution, balancing research and teaching, and serves a diverse community of approximately 30,000 undergraduate and graduate students across 13 faculties and 11 graduate schools. Its scale and legacy establish Toyo as a major player in Japanese higher education.
